Studio Album, released in 2011

Songs / Tracks Listing

1. Lament (4:53)
2. Nascent (4:09)
3. Concealing Fate, Part 1: Acceptance (8:33)
4. Concealing Fate, Part 2: Deception (5:22)
5. Concealing Fate, Part 3: The Impossible (4:50)
6. Concealing Fate, Part 4: Perfection (2:38)
7. Concealing Fate, Part 5: Epiphany (1:29)
8. Concealing Fate, Part 6: Origin (4:44)
9. Sunrise (3:57)
10. April (4:48)
11. Eden (9:08)

Total Time 54:31

Line-up / Musicians

- Daniel Tompkins / vocals
- Acle Kahney / guitar
- James Monteith / guitar
- Amos Williams / bass
- Jamie Postones / drums

Releases information

Artwork: Amos Williams

CD Century Media ‎- 9980432 (2011, Europe)

2LP Century Media ‎- 9980431 (2011, Europe) LP2 has the instrumental version of the album
